.elementor-4662 .elementor-element.elementor-element-1e738df{--display:flex;}.elementor-4662 .elementor-element.elementor-element-7fa428b .elementor-heading-title{font-family:var( --e-global-typography-ea2be0d-font-family ), san-serif;font-size:var( --e-global-typography-ea2be0d-font-size );font-weight:var( --e-global-typography-ea2be0d-font-weight );line-height:var( --e-global-typography-ea2be0d-line-height );}.elementor-4662 .elementor-element.elementor-element-2d79866{--display:flex;}.elementor-4662 .elementor-element.elementor-element-13f25a2 .elementor-heading-title{font-family:var( --e-global-typography-2a3fc13-font-family ), san-serif;font-size:var( --e-global-typography-2a3fc13-font-size );font-weight:var( --e-global-typography-2a3fc13-font-weight );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-dcb8339 .elementor-heading-title{font-family:var( --e-global-typography-2a3fc13-font-family ), san-serif;font-size:var( --e-global-typography-2a3fc13-font-size );font-weight:var( --e-global-typography-2a3fc13-font-weight );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-ac0d280 .elementor-heading-title{font-family:var( --e-global-typography-2a3fc13-font-family ), san-serif;font-size:var( --e-global-typography-2a3fc13-font-size );font-weight:var( --e-global-typography-2a3fc13-font-weight );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-aea82e8 .elementor-heading-title{font-family:var( --e-global-typography-2a3fc13-font-family ), san-serif;font-size:var( --e-global-typography-2a3fc13-font-size );font-weight:var( --e-global-typography-2a3fc13-font-weight );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-e368c20 .elementor-heading-title{font-family:var( --e-global-typography-2a3fc13-font-family ), san-serif;font-size:var( --e-global-typography-2a3fc13-font-size );font-weight:var( --e-global-typography-2a3fc13-font-weight );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-88e9908 .elementor-heading-title{font-family:var( --e-global-typography-2a3fc13-font-family ), san-serif;font-size:var( --e-global-typography-2a3fc13-font-size );font-weight:var( --e-global-typography-2a3fc13-font-weight );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-a935515{--divider-border-style:solid;--divider-color:#000;--divider-border-width:1px;}.elementor-4662 .elementor-element.elementor-element-a935515 .elementor-divider-separator{width:100%;}.elementor-4662 .elementor-element.elementor-element-a935515 .elementor-divider{padding-block-start:15px;padding-block-end:15px;}.elementor-4662 .elementor-element.elementor-element-166c077{--display:grid;--e-con-grid-template-columns:repeat(2, 1fr);--e-con-grid-template-rows:repeat(1, 1fr);--grid-auto-flow:row;}.elementor-4662 .elementor-element.elementor-element-79d32a1 > .elementor-widget-container{margin:031px 0px 0px 0px;}.elementor-4662 .elementor-element.elementor-element-79d32a1{font-family:var( --e-global-typography-fcba14e-font-family ), san-serif;font-size:var( --e-global-typography-fcba14e-font-size );font-weight:var( --e-global-typography-fcba14e-font-weight );}.elementor-4662 .elementor-element.elementor-element-1c6e7c1.elementor-element{--align-self:center;}@media(max-width:1366px){.elementor-4662 .elementor-element.elementor-element-7fa428b .elementor-heading-title{font-size:var( --e-global-typography-ea2be0d-font-size );line-height:var( --e-global-typography-ea2be0d-line-height );}.elementor-4662 .elementor-element.elementor-element-13f25a2 .elementor-heading-title{font-size:var( --e-global-typography-2a3fc13-font-size );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-dcb8339 .elementor-heading-title{font-size:var( --e-global-typography-2a3fc13-font-size );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-ac0d280 .elementor-heading-title{font-size:var( --e-global-typography-2a3fc13-font-size );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-aea82e8 .elementor-heading-title{font-size:var( --e-global-typography-2a3fc13-font-size );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-e368c20 .elementor-heading-title{font-size:var( --e-global-typography-2a3fc13-font-size );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-88e9908 .elementor-heading-title{font-size:var( --e-global-typography-2a3fc13-font-size );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-166c077{--grid-auto-flow:row;}.elementor-4662 .elementor-element.elementor-element-79d32a1{font-size:var( --e-global-typography-fcba14e-font-size );}}@media(max-width:1200px){.elementor-4662 .elementor-element.elementor-element-166c077{--grid-auto-flow:row;}}@media(max-width:1153px){.elementor-4662 .elementor-element.elementor-element-7fa428b .elementor-heading-title{font-size:var( --e-global-typography-ea2be0d-font-size );line-height:var( --e-global-typography-ea2be0d-line-height );}.elementor-4662 .elementor-element.elementor-element-13f25a2 .elementor-heading-title{font-size:var( --e-global-typography-2a3fc13-font-size );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-dcb8339 .elementor-heading-title{font-size:var( --e-global-typography-2a3fc13-font-size );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-ac0d280 .elementor-heading-title{font-size:var( --e-global-typography-2a3fc13-font-size );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-aea82e8 .elementor-heading-title{font-size:var( --e-global-typography-2a3fc13-font-size );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-e368c20 .elementor-heading-title{font-size:var( --e-global-typography-2a3fc13-font-size );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-88e9908 .elementor-heading-title{font-size:var( --e-global-typography-2a3fc13-font-size );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-166c077{--grid-auto-flow:row;}.elementor-4662 .elementor-element.elementor-element-79d32a1{font-size:var( --e-global-typography-fcba14e-font-size );}}@media(max-width:880px){.elementor-4662 .elementor-element.elementor-element-166c077{--grid-auto-flow:row;}}@media(max-width:767px){.elementor-4662 .elementor-element.elementor-element-7fa428b .elementor-heading-title{font-size:var( --e-global-typography-ea2be0d-font-size );line-height:var( --e-global-typography-ea2be0d-line-height );}.elementor-4662 .elementor-element.elementor-element-13f25a2 .elementor-heading-title{font-size:var( --e-global-typography-2a3fc13-font-size );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-dcb8339 .elementor-heading-title{font-size:var( --e-global-typography-2a3fc13-font-size );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-ac0d280 .elementor-heading-title{font-size:var( --e-global-typography-2a3fc13-font-size );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-aea82e8 .elementor-heading-title{font-size:var( --e-global-typography-2a3fc13-font-size );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-e368c20 .elementor-heading-title{font-size:var( --e-global-typography-2a3fc13-font-size );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-88e9908 .elementor-heading-title{font-size:var( --e-global-typography-2a3fc13-font-size );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-166c077{--e-con-grid-template-columns:repeat(1, 1fr);--grid-auto-flow:row;}.elementor-4662 .elementor-element.elementor-element-79d32a1{font-size:var( --e-global-typography-fcba14e-font-size );}}@media(min-width:2400px){.elementor-4662 .elementor-element.elementor-element-7fa428b .elementor-heading-title{font-size:var( --e-global-typography-ea2be0d-font-size );line-height:var( --e-global-typography-ea2be0d-line-height );}.elementor-4662 .elementor-element.elementor-element-13f25a2 .elementor-heading-title{font-size:var( --e-global-typography-2a3fc13-font-size );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-dcb8339 .elementor-heading-title{font-size:var( --e-global-typography-2a3fc13-font-size );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-ac0d280 .elementor-heading-title{font-size:var( --e-global-typography-2a3fc13-font-size );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-aea82e8 .elementor-heading-title{font-size:var( --e-global-typography-2a3fc13-font-size );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-e368c20 .elementor-heading-title{font-size:var( --e-global-typography-2a3fc13-font-size );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-88e9908 .elementor-heading-title{font-size:var( --e-global-typography-2a3fc13-font-size );line-height:var( --e-global-typography-2a3fc13-line-height );letter-spacing:var( --e-global-typography-2a3fc13-letter-spacing );}.elementor-4662 .elementor-element.elementor-element-166c077{--grid-auto-flow:row;}.elementor-4662 .elementor-element.elementor-element-79d32a1{font-size:var( --e-global-typography-fcba14e-font-size );}}